02. Singapore’s Heat: Is Your Room Too Warm?Singapore’s Heat

Our tropical climate is a major hurdle for quality rest. Biology dictates that your core body temperature must drop by roughly 1–2°C to initiate and maintain deep sleep.

  • The Problem: If your room is too warm, your body stays in a state of high metabolic activity to try and cool itself down, preventing you from reaching the “REM” and “Deep Sleep” stages.

  • The Tip: Aim for a room temperature between 18–20°C.

03. The Blue Light Sabotage

In a digital-first city, our “wind-down” often involves scrolling through news or social media. However, your brain can’t tell the difference between the sun and your smartphone.

  • The Problem: Blue light suppresses melatonin, the hormone responsible for sleep. By using screens right up until lights-out, you’re essentially “tricking” your brain into staying in an alert, daytime mode.

  • The Fix: Power down all screens at least 45 minutes before bed. Replace the scroll with a physical book or light stretching to signal to your brain that it’s time for recovery.

04. The Myth of “Catching Up” on Sleep Debt

Think you can make up for a stressful work week with a 12-hour sleep on Sunday? Science says otherwise. Sleep debt is cumulative and hard to “pay back.”

  • The Problem: One long session of sleep cannot undo a week of deprivation. In fact, oversleeping on weekends can disrupt your internal clock (circadian rhythm), making Monday morning even harder.

  • The Strategy: Consistency beats catch-up every time. Try to keep your wake-up time within a 30-minute window, even on weekends. This builds “sleep pressure” naturally, helping you fall asleep faster and wake up more refreshed.
